Setting date and time

When the unit is turned on for the first time, a message asking you to set
the date and time will appear.
Press the MENU/SET button and perform steps 2 to 3 below to set the
date and time.
1
Select the menu. (l 32)
: [CLOCK SET] # desired setting
[DATE]:
[TIME]:
2
Select the items to be set using 1 and 2
on the cursor button, and set the desired
value using T and W.
≥ The year can be set between 2000 and 2039.
≥ The 12-hour system is used to display the time.
3
Press the MENU/SET button.
≥ The clock function starts at [00] seconds.
≥ Press 2 to complete the setting.
≥ The clock is not set when the unit is shipped.
≥ The date and time function is driven by a built-in lithium battery.
≥ If the built-in lithium battery needs to be charged, the message "Set
date and time" appears. To recharge the built-in lithium battery,
connect USB terminal of this unit to a booted PC or attach the battery
to this unit. Leave the unit as it is for approx. 24 hours and the battery
will maintain the date and time for approx. 3 months. (The battery is still
being recharged even if the unit is off.)
≥ The date and time will be set to January 1, 2010 00:00 when recording
is performed without the date and time set.
